  • It is SOOOO tempting to jump on and off the scales! But then so soul destroying when they move in every direction except the one you want them to...!

    I read somewhere a fairly fool-proof way of dealing with this...throw your scales out, find a pay and weigh scale in a shop and once a week, weigh yourself in as near as possible the same condition that you were weighed in, the previous week.This way, you know the scales are in the same spot, and because of having to pay, say 20p everytime you weigh, you will soon find yourself only weighing once a week!!!
    I think this could be a good plan, for I am one of those that jumps on the scale two or three times a day, if I am not happy with the first result!!! But, as yet I have not been strong enough to carry this out....one day....one day!
